Date: October 4, 2019 Venue: Landmark Event Centre Time: 8:00am prompt [Register here]( Four startups have been named winners of the African leg of the[MIT Inclusive Innovation Challenge]( will now advance to the global final for the chance to win US$250,000 in prize money. They are: Egyptian on-demand services platform [Taskty]( Kenyan daycare platform [Tiny Totos]( Nigerian lending service [Social Lender]( and South African retailer stock-ordering app [Shopit](. The MIT Inclusive Innovation Challenge, organised by the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) offers cash prizes to entrepreneurs from around the world that have developed technological solutions to empower working people and encourage economic growth. International money transfer platform, [WorldRemit, has brought its cash pick-up option]( to its customers in Nigeria. Customers in Nigeria can now receive money from their benefactors in the diaspora in cash at FCMB Bank, Fidelity Bank, Access Bank, Zenith Bank, and Polaris Bank branches across the country. Egyptian delivery aggregator platform, Voo, [has announced the launch]( pick-up service for last-mile delivery. Voo offers delivery solutions to any e-commerce business that has a monthly volume as low as 50 orders a month, allowing them to integrate its service in their e-commerce platforms through its API. The service has launched with 50 outlets across Egypt with plans to increase this number to 70 by year end. A bill called the Kenya Information and Communication (Amendment) Bill 2019, which is on its way to the country's parliament, [is seeking the strength of the law]( to regulate social media group activities as well as activities of bloggers in the country. If the bill is passed, bloggers will be required to register with the Communications Authority of Kenya (CA) or face a US$4,800 fine or jail term. The aim of the bill is reportedly to curb the spread of fake news and misinformation which is rampant across social media groups and unverifiable blog sources. [Kenya is one of a number of African countries]( where governments are cracking down on social media freedoms either through legislation or by imposing taxes. South Africa's largest financial union, South African Society of Bank Officials (SASBO), is [set to begin a nationwide strike]( on Friday, September 27 over shifting tides in the country's banking sector which is culminating in job losses. The union says the sector's plans to pivot to digital tools and services are taking the livelihood of its members and has planned five marches throughout the country in Johannesburg, Durban, Bloemfontein, Port Elizabeth, and Cape Town. The union has threatened to shut down automated teller machines across the country as well as internet banking facilities. The Business Unity South Africa (BUSA) will head to court sometime today to attempt to halt the planned strike action.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
